A Graduate Certificate in Heavy Metal Pollution equips students with the necessary knowledge and skills to assess, manage, and mitigate heavy metal pollution in various environmental settings. The program focuses on understanding the sources of heavy metal contamination, its impact on ecosystems and human health, and effective remediation strategies.
Upon completion of the certificate, students will be able to identify heavy metal pollutants, evaluate their risks, and develop strategies to minimize their harmful effects on the environment. They will also gain practical experience in conducting fieldwork, analyzing data, and communicating their findings to stakeholders.
